While Let's Calendar specializes in calendar scheduling, Trello and Asana help teams visualize projects and assign ownership. Trello's kanban board interface is perfect for smaller teams managing campaigns. Asana, meanwhile, offers dependencies and workload balancing, ideal for more complex events.
Both tools integrate well with Gmail, Slack, and calendar apps, making them part of your broader organization management tools ecosystem.

Airtable combines spreadsheet logic with intuitive UI, ideal for storing speaker lists, RSVP statuses, or booth logistics. Notion, on the other hand, works as a hybrid workspace — notes, task boards, wikis, and CRM rolled into one.
These business organizing tools are adaptable and help create shared knowledge bases across teams.
